We started off today with the cook team being abruptly woken by a 6:45 alarm to help prepare breakfast. The others had a little lay in until 7, breakfast was amazing as everyone was craving fruit salad and we got presented with the biggest bowl we could&#8217;ve imagined. Breakfast was followed by a visit to the kindergarten owned by the lovely hostel we&#8217;re staying in. Everyone loved seeing all the young children in awe with plastic Easter eggs filled with sweets. Our morning was ended by playing traditional Sri Lankan games (which we played at the end of visiting MEF) and was adorable to see the children really getting involved and showing us how to play. Esha made two little friends who decided to put flowers throughout her hair and only wanted to sit next to her. We were then presented with a scrumptious lunch of rice, fish curry, mushroom crisp things (not quite sure what they were called) and cooked pumpkin which we managed to consume very quickly.<\/p>\n<p> Our afternoon started with a quick dash into our uniform before a short drive (with air con which was heaven) to Tzu Chi school where we met our buddies with lots of nerves but also excitement to get to know them and their culture further. Our buddies lead us to a welcoming assembly with many dances and drama performances; however we had to do an unexpected speech in front of our buddies and their families which was nerve racking for some. Presented with lots of sweet snacks we tucked into them in a classroom and was overwhelmed with the amount we enjoyed it and the different ways to cook or eat things. After all our nerves turned into feeling ecstatic we played a Sri Lankan game called &#8216;Elle&#8217; which is a mix between rounders and baseball. Splitting into two teams, Hamish and hatty hit amazing shots, i hit the ball but slipped while running and then laughed in embarrassment and Esha caching the ball when she shouldn&#8217;t have made up our entertainment for an hour. After a few hours at Tzu Chi school we said farewell to our buddies for today and told them our plans for tomorrow which we are all very excited about (you&#8217;ll have to wait for tomorrow&#8217;s blog to find out what we are going to do) and got back onto our bus. <\/p>\n<p>Once again all so thankful for the air con to cool us down, we set off for Hambantota to buy material for our sari&#8217;s with help from the teacher at Tzu Chi school. A few hours later of picking and choosing through lots different colours and types of fabric, everyone had their material for the sari and the shirt\/skirt to go underneath. Of course Hamish took 5 minutes to pick his but had to wait for all the girls, oops! We then set back off to go to a seamstress to get measured for the material to fit us correctly to pick up in a few days time so wait for photos!<\/p>\n<p>Tonight we&#8217;ve had a relaxed evening of another incredible dinner of NON-SPICY PASTA!
